nothing new really, it just flips out another portion so there is room for your On-car and a IE guy to ride with you.

That's exactly what it is. My buddy had one installed on his P1200 over a year ago. It's a seat that is installed on a sliding rail in the floor. The seat when not being used slides behind the drivers seat. When used, the seat is directly in front of the bulkhead door. I really don't see a reason for it other than for a driver to have 2 additional people riding with him. My buddy hasn't had anyone ride with him to use the seat and it's been over a year. I can see the driver struggling to get through the day when it's being used as you have to wait for the person in the seat to unbuckle and slide the seat back to it's original position before you can even open the bulkhead door.
